How to Make Lemon Lime Detox Water

So, why were these ingredients chosen for my detox water? Here is a quick look at each ingredient and what it offers in terms of our health:

  • Cucumbers contain citrulline which is an amino acid. It helps flush ammonia from our liver and kidneys which is produced during our body’s breakdown of protein.
  • Lemons are good for digestion and help relieve constipation, bloating and gas thus helping slim our waistline.
  • Mint helps improve the flow of bile, which aids in the breakdown of dietary fat.
  • Limes have a similar benefit to our bodies as lemons. You can read more about the health benefits of limes to see what amazing and TASTY little fruits they are!

You can make up this detox water in bulk and refill the water portion of the drink several times before having to replace the fruits and veggies. Invest in a large glass jug with a spout like the one from Alladin. Once you have the fruits and vegetables added, just fill with water and leave it in the fridge for use throughout the day. General rule of thumb is that we should be drinking 6 to 8 glasses of water per day (approximately 8 ounces each). Drink more or less, depending on personal preference.

Lemon Lime Detox Water

Yield: 2 liters

Lemon Lime Detox Water Recipe

How to Make Lemon Lime Detox Water

Refreshing way to detox our bodies and stay hydrated.

Prep Time 10 minutes
Total Time 10 minutes

Ingredients

  • 2 liters of water
  • 1 large cucumber, thinly sliced
  • 2 limes, thinly sliced
  • 2 lemons, thinly sliced
  • 1 cup fresh mint leaves
  • ice

Instructions

  1. Put mint, fruits and vegetables into a large glass container with a spout for pouring.
  2. Fill with water and ice
  3. Drink 6 to 8 cups per day
  4. Keep refrigerated and use within 2 to 3 days
